Clean and gorgeous example of a Ruger M77 in .416 Rigby, like new in original box with paperwork. I believe it is mid 90’s model. Beautiful darker blonde wood with checkered fore grip and fore stock with black cap.

$1850 plus shipping to your FFL CONUS.
